Chapter 3. Performance
Adding Reverberation to the Sound (Reverb)
Apply a reverb effect to the notes you play with the RG-3M.
Reverb makes it sound as if you are playing in a concert hall.
1.
Press the [Function] (Exit) button so the indicator is lit.
2.
Press the [Song] (Select -) button or [ ] (Select +) button to
display the EFFECT screen.
fig.03-340d
3.
Press the [Song] (Select -) button or [ ] (Select +) button to get
the value for “Reverb” to flash.
fig.03-350d
4.
Press the [ ] (Value -) button or [ ] (Value +) button to
change the amount of reverb applied.
5.
Press the [Function] (Exit) button so the indicator goes out.
Value
Description
0–127
Increasing the value results in a deeper reverb effect.
No reverb is applied when the value is set to “0.”
